  • The first rule of the internet is when the cursor of your mouse pointer turns into a hand click on the left mouse button and you will go to another page or play something for you. 
    Look and click here.

  • As you read down the page you will want to continue using the  scroll bar --------------------------------->
    which is located on the right side of your screen.

  • What you are seeing outside of this white space is called a background.   This background is made by a picture called an image.

  • When you are reading if you see a word that is underlined put the mouse cursor over the word and see if it is a hyper link.
